### **Pros and Cons of buying a ASS PC-L0873 9413-D HVAC Control Circuit Board (PCN-0481, PCB 7x5)**

#### **Pros:**

1. **Compatibility** This circuit board is specifically designed for certain HVAC systems, ensuring proper functionality when installed in the correct model. If your system requires this exact part (PCN-0481), it will fit without modification.

2. **Reliability** If the original board was failing due to a known issue (e.g., faulty components, wear, or manufacturing defect), a new, genuine replacement should restore system performance. Many HVAC systems rely on precise control signals, and a faulty board can cause erratic operation or complete failure.

3. **OEM Quality** If purchased from an authorized dealer or the manufacturer, this part will meet the same quality standards as the original equipment. This reduces the risk of compatibility issues or premature failure compared to aftermarket knockoffs.

4. **Warranty Coverage** Some suppliers offer warranties or return policies, providing peace of mind in case of defects. If the board fails shortly after installation, you may be able to get a replacement under warranty.

5. **Prevents Further Damage** A failing control board can cause the HVAC system to malfunction, potentially leading to compressor damage, refrigerant leaks, or electrical issues. Replacing it early can prevent costly repairs down the line.

6. **Ease of Installation** Since it is a direct replacement, installation typically involves only unplugging the old board, removing screws, and connecting the new one. No major rewiring or reprogramming is usually required.

7. **Long-Term Cost Savings** If the issue was indeed the control board, replacing it may be cheaper than repairing or replacing the entire HVAC unit. Regular HVAC maintenance can also extend the lifespan of the system.

---

#### **Cons:**

1. **High Cost** HVAC control boards, especially OEM parts, can be expensive. If the system is older, the cost may outweigh the benefits of repair. A full system replacement might be more economical in some cases.

2. **Potential Counterfeit Parts** If purchased from an untrusted seller (e.g., eBay, Amazon third-party, or unknown online marketplaces), there is a risk of receiving a fake or low-quality replica. Counterfeit parts may not function correctly and could cause further damage.

3. **Complex Diagnostics Required** Before purchasing, you must confirm that the board is indeed the source of the problem. Symptoms like error codes, erratic operation, or complete system shutdowns may require professional diagnosis to avoid wasting money on an unnecessary replacement.

4. **Labor Costs** Even if the part is cheap, HVAC technicians charge labor fees for installation. If the system is in a hard-to-reach location, costs may increase.

5. **Limited Availability** Some OEM parts become discontinued, making them difficult to find. If the supplier is unreliable, you may face long wait times or stockouts.

6. **Learning Curve for DIY Installation** While straightforward, improper handling (e.g., static discharge, incorrect wiring) can damage the board or other components. Those without technical experience may prefer hiring a professional.

7. **System Age and Overall Condition** If the HVAC unit is old (e.g., 15 years) or has other failing components (e.g., compressor, fan motor), replacing just the control board may provide temporary relief but not a long-term solution. In such cases, upgrading the entire system could be more cost-effective.

8. **Potential for Overkill** If the issue is minor (e.g., a loose wire, a failing sensor), replacing the entire control board may be unnecessary. A technician should first confirm the exact problem.

### **Recommendation:**

1. **Verify the Problem** Before purchasing, have a technician diagnose the HVAC system to confirm the control board is the issue. Some symptoms (e.g., error codes) can point to other failures (e.g., refrigerant leaks, sensor malfunctions).

2. **Purchase from a Trusted Source** Buy directly from the manufacturer, an authorized dealer, or a reputable HVAC parts supplier (e.g., Grainger, McMaster-Carr, or local HVAC distributors) to avoid counterfeit parts.

3. **Compare Costs** Get quotes for:

- The control board replacement (parts labor).

- A full HVAC system replacement (if the unit is old).

- Alternative repairs (e.g., sensor replacement, capacitor swap).

Decide based on which option offers the best balance of cost and longevity.

4. **Consider Professional Installation** Unless you have experience with HVAC systems, hiring a licensed technician ensures proper installation, reducing the risk of voiding warranties or causing further damage.

5. **Check Warranty Options** If the system is under warranty, the manufacturer may cover the control board replacement. Always exhaust warranty claims before paying out of pocket.

6. **Evaluate System Lifespan** If the HVAC unit is nearing the end of its expected life (typically 15 20 years for modern systems), replacing just the control board may not be worth it. In such cases, upgrading to a newer, more efficient unit could save money in the long run.
